Problem
Conventional message playback devices lack the capability to coordinate message playback with specific environments and user needs, failing to interact contextually and provide self-contained configurations suitable for environments like refrigerators and automobiles.
Innovation Solution
The technology involves storing user behavior interactive messages and sensing user-generated environment events to automatically coordinate and play back contextually relevant messages, using an automated system with sensors and processors to analyze and deliver messages based on user behavior and environmental conditions.

A system for playback of messages. Context appropriate messages for an environment may be played back. Messages may be user behavior interactive and subject to user behavior initiated message playback conditions. User generated environment events may be automatically analyzed and user behavior interactive messages may be automatically coordinated. An automated themed message playback apparatus may have a self-contained housing within which a stored themed message, an in situ user generated environment event sensor, and an automated themed message playback device are housed. User generated environment events may be automatically sensed in situ.
